Electrical System Troubleshooting

Proper electrical functionality is essential for a smooth swap. Electrical problems often manifest as erratic behavior, including intermittent power loss, faulty gauges, or a complete engine shutdown. A systematic approach to diagnosing electrical problems involves checking fuses, relays, wiring connections, and sensor readings. Inspecting wiring harnesses for damage and ensuring proper grounding are vital steps. Consider using a multimeter to verify voltage and current readings.

Fuel System Issues

A well-tuned fuel system is critical for optimal engine performance. Problems can range from fuel leaks to incorrect fuel pressure. Regular checks of fuel lines and components are recommended to prevent leaks and ensure efficient fuel delivery. Proper fuel pressure regulation is essential, and issues can be diagnosed using a fuel pressure gauge. Fuel injectors’ functionality should also be verified.

Ignition System Diagnostics

A well-functioning ignition system is vital for reliable engine operation. Problems may manifest as rough idling, misfires, or hesitation during acceleration. Spark plug condition and coil pack integrity are crucial aspects to inspect. Testing the ignition system involves checking spark plug gaps, coil pack resistance, and distributor operation (if applicable). Inspecting the distributor cap and rotor for damage is also a key step.

Potential Issues with Troubleshooting Steps and Solutions, 300zx 2jz swap kit

Potential Issue Troubleshooting Steps Solutions
Intermittent Engine Stalling Check spark plugs, wires, and fuel delivery system. Inspect the ignition coil and associated wiring. Replace faulty components, tighten connections, and address any fuel delivery issues.
Rough Idling Verify air intake and exhaust system for leaks. Examine fuel pressure and mixture. Repair or replace leaks, adjust fuel mixture, and ensure proper airflow.
Poor Acceleration Inspect air filter, throttle position sensor, and fuel injectors. Verify timing belt alignment. Replace or clean clogged filters, calibrate sensors, and adjust timing if needed.
